CI note: PickPath optimizer pipeline failures

The PickPath warehouse pick-list optimizer has been failing its integration stage intermittently since Tuesday. The failures trace to the synthetic warehouse fixture on the Brennick runner, which occasionally generates an aisle layout with zero valid routes, crashing the solver. A retry usually passes, so do not block the release train on a single red run; rerun once before escalating. The fixture fix lands next sprint. For audit purposes, the last known-good pipeline run carries the token below.

session token of bajog-tadup = htk3_ffc

**09:47 — Sprinklers go rogue.** Quick recap for the new folks: our Verdello plant-watering scheduler started re-running the dawn cycle every twenty minutes because a timezone fix made "last watered" timestamps look stale. The greenhouse crew at the Maplestead site noticed puddles first and pulled the breaker — honestly the right call. Priya rolled the scheduler back by 10:15 and we drained the duplicate job queue. Nothing died except one very soggy fern. The rollback target was identified by the build token below.

trace token, fafog-kageg: htk4_98e6

Finance Review — Lease Renegotiation Summary

Renegotiated the Bracken Quay office lease: term extended to 2031, base rent cut 9%, landlord funds the floor-three refit. Break clause retained at year five. Annual savings roughly offset the Pellan depot rate increase. Net facilities cost flat year over year. No action needed from sales this quarter. The plans driving the extended commitment are noted below.

confidential, kagep-kahof: Druokax Systems plans to lower the Ulaath list price by 53 percent in March.